The village of Iitate has consistently ranked
as one of Japan’s most beautiful communities over recent years (www.utsukushii-mura.jp/). Situated in
a verdant area of Fukushima that has long boasted a history of agriculture and
beef farming.
Sadly, the village is also located approximately 39 kilometres northwest of the Fukushima nuclear power plant. This is slightly outside of the 30 kilometre radiation exclusion zone around the plant, but the village was evacuated in April 2011 on the advice of the authorities. Most families have relocated to other parts of Fukushima, and are living in temporary accommodation, with the children attending new schools.
